**UNSUPPORTED WHEN ASSIGNED** Insecure default credentials for the Telnet function in the legacy DSL CPE Zyxel VMG4325-B10A firmware version 1.00(AAFR.4)C0_20170615 could allow an attacker to log in to the management interface if the administrators have the option to change the default credentials but fail to do so.

CVE-2025-0890 has a high severity rating due to the use of insecure default credentials.
To fix CVE-2025-0890, change the default Telnet credentials immediately after setup.
CVE-2025-0890 specifically affects the Zyxel VMG4325-B10A firmware version 1.00(AAFR.4)C0_20170615.
CVE-2025-0890 can allow unauthorized remote access to the router's management interface, potentially compromising the device.
